Millboard® Composite Decking

Luxury Hand-Moulded Decking That Looks and Feels Like Real Timber

Millboard® decking is the premium choice for architects, designers, and homeowners who refuse to compromise on aesthetics. Unlike standard extruded composites, every Millboard® plank is hand-moulded from real timber masters and finished with a mineral-rich Lastane surface that replicates the knots, grain, and texture of natural hardwood with remarkable fidelity. Master Woodturning stocks the full Millboard® collection at our Sydney showroom, allowing you to compare the Weathered Oak, Enhanced Grain, and Carbonised ranges in person. Millboard® is non-porous and will not absorb moisture, making it exceptionally resistant to algae, mould, and staining – perfect for shaded areas, coastal properties, and poolside installations where standing water is common. The boards contain no wood fibre at all, eliminating the risk of rot, swelling, and insect damage entirely. With Millboard®, you get the visual warmth of timber with the lifetime performance of a truly engineered product.

FREQUENTLY ASKED QUESTIONS

What is composite decking and why should I choose it over timber?

Composite decking is an engineered outdoor flooring material made from a blend of recycled wood fibres and polymer resins. It replicates the look and feel of natural timber but eliminates the ongoing maintenance, there’s no need for sanding, staining, oiling, or sealing. Composite boards are termite-proof, slip-rated, UV-stable, and backed by manufacturer warranties of up to 50 years. Over its lifetime, composite decking typically costs less than timber when you factor in the savings on annual maintenance products and labour.

Can I use composite decking around a swimming pool?

Absolutely. Most of the composite decking brands we stock achieve a P5 or higher slip rating, making them suitable for use around swimming pools and wet areas. Composite boards are also non-porous and resistant to chlorine, salt, and moisture, ideal for pool surrounds where standing water is common. What decking is suitable for bushfire-prone areas (BAL zones)?

ModWood Flame Shield composite decking is rated to BAL-40, making it compliant for use in bushfire-prone areas including BAL-12.5, BAL-19, BAL-29, and BAL-40 zones.
